Pressure reducing valves (PRV) are installed in domestic water systems to reduce and stabilise the inlet pressure from the mains supply, which is generally too high and variable for domestic appliances to function properly.

Another possibility that I forgot to mention is that the expansion vessel could be undersized - if the EV cannot cope with the amount of hot water expansion in the system it will then have to go somewhere else (the PRV).
